What does cockfighting day mean?

Watching the cockfighting date is simply understood as the act of looking at the date to show the chickens to compete with the cocker or the player bets on the date to see which part of the cock will be able to win today. This is considered a spiritual factor that is highly appreciated by cockfighters and bettors and cannot be ignored before a cockfighting match takes place.

Currently, there are many different ways to calculate cockfighting dates on the market. You can rely on feng shui elements such as: Looking at the 12 zodiac animals, using the color of the rooster’s life, considering the day according to the five elements or the lunar calendar. Each method will have different advantages, but they are all just information for viewers to refer to, so you don’t need to put too much emphasis on this issue.
